通用载波恢复算法研究及FPGA实现

摘    要:阐述了通用载波恢复环实现16QAM信号的载波恢复算法及该算法在FPGA上的工程实现。详细介绍了通用载波恢复环的工作原理,并利用System Generator对其进行建模与仿真。仿真结果表明,该环路能够轻松地实现高速解调信号的基带处理,准确的对载波频率、载波相位进行同步,保证了良好的稳态跟踪性能,而且信道噪声对载波同步的影响较小。

关 键 词:16QAM  载波同步  通用载波恢复环  System Generator

Abstract:Explain how a universal carrier recovery loop achieves carrier recovery algorithms for 16QAM signal and its project implementation in FPGA .The working principle of the universal loop is described in detail and system generator is used for its modeling and simulation. The simulation result shows that the loop can easily achieve high-speed baseband demodulation signals, and accurately synchronize the carrier frequency and the carrier phase and the design has better stability. It is found that the channel noise has little effect on carrier synchronization.
